Dubai: Abu Dhabi Comedy Season is adding another major name to its third edition, with American comedian, writer and podcaster Whitney Cummings set to perform at Etihad Arena on January 31, 2027.
Cummings will take the stage for an early show, followed by British comedian Paul Smith, who is also scheduled to perform at the venue later that day.
Organised by Live Nation Middle East in partnership with the Department of Culture and Tourism – Abu Dhabi and Miral, Abu Dhabi Comedy Season is returning for its third edition with a star-studded line-up of international comedy acts.
Cummings joins an already announced roster featuring Morgan Jay on October 11, Russell Peters on October 25, Mo Amer on November 6, Maz Jobrani on November 7 and Paul Smith on January 31.
More acts and performances are expected to be announced as the season unfolds.
Who is Whitney Cummings?
Whitney Cummings is one of the most recognisable names in American comedy, with a career spanning stand-up, television, writing and podcasting. Known for her sharp observational humour and candid style, she has built a strong following through her comedy specials, television work and popular podcast.
At just 29, Cummings created two network television sitcoms that premiered in the same season — CBS’ 2 Broke Girls and NBC’s Whitney, in which she also starred.
Since then, she has appeared in numerous television shows and films and released six stand-up comedy specials. Cummings also served as an executive producer on ABC’s Roseanne and hosts the popular podcast Good For You.
Currently on her Big Baby stand-up tour, which runs through 2027, Cummings will bring her signature comedy to Abu Dhabi as part of the capital’s growing comedy scene.
Her Abu Dhabi show will take place on January 31, 2027, at Etihad Arena on Yas Island.
